From dc2df694c7fe8a2e1b96840ffca88616ff6ed11f Mon Sep 17 00:00:00 2001 From: Maya Peretz Date: Tue, 27 Aug 2024 14:12:10 +0300 Subject: [PATCH] Source extra_env.sh file if exists in integration tests Signed-off-by: Maya Peretz --- tests/integration/targets/inventory_kubevirt/runme.sh | 4 ++++ tests/integration/targets/kubevirt_vm/runme.sh | 4 ++++ tests/integration/targets/kubevirt_vm_info/runme.sh | 4 ++++ tests/integration/targets/kubevirt_vmi_info/runme.sh | 4 ++++ 4 files changed, 16 insertions(+) diff --git a/tests/integration/targets/inventory_kubevirt/runme.sh b/tests/integration/targets/inventory_kubevirt/runme.sh index 875a95f..ea57dba 100755 --- a/tests/integration/targets/inventory_kubevirt/runme.sh +++ b/tests/integration/targets/inventory_kubevirt/runme.sh @@ -4,6 +4,10 @@ set -eux export ANSIBLE_CALLBACKS_ENABLED=ansible.posix.profile_tasks export ANSIBLE_INVENTORY_ENABLED=kubevirt.core.kubevirt +if [ -f "extra_vars.sh" ]; then + source extra_vars.sh +fi + NAMESPACE="test-inventory-kubevirt-$(tr -dc '[:lower:]' < /dev/urandom | head -c 5)" SECONDARY_NETWORK=${SECONDARY_NETWORK:-default/kindexgw} diff --git a/tests/integration/targets/kubevirt_vm/runme.sh b/tests/integration/targets/kubevirt_vm/runme.sh index 4bf1682..dfd8f26 100755 --- a/tests/integration/targets/kubevirt_vm/runme.sh +++ b/tests/integration/targets/kubevirt_vm/runme.sh @@ -5,6 +5,10 @@ export ANSIBLE_CALLBACKS_ENABLED=ansible.posix.profile_tasks export ANSIBLE_INVENTORY_ENABLED=kubevirt.core.kubevirt export ANSIBLE_HOST_KEY_CHECKING=False +if [ -f "extra_vars.sh" ]; then + source extra_vars.sh +fi + NAMESPACE="test-kubevirt-vm-$(tr -dc '[:lower:]' < /dev/urandom | head -c 5)" SECONDARY_NETWORK=${SECONDARY_NETWORK:-default/kindexgw} diff --git a/tests/integration/targets/kubevirt_vm_info/runme.sh b/tests/integration/targets/kubevirt_vm_info/runme.sh index d72ad1b..2a4ba7c 100755 --- a/tests/integration/targets/kubevirt_vm_info/runme.sh +++ b/tests/integration/targets/kubevirt_vm_info/runme.sh @@ -3,6 +3,10 @@ set -eux export ANSIBLE_CALLBACKS_ENABLED=ansible.posix.profile_tasks +if [ -f "extra_vars.sh" ]; then + source extra_vars.sh +fi + NAMESPACE="test-kubevirt-vm-info-$(tr -dc '[:lower:]' < /dev/urandom | head -c 5)" cleanup() { diff --git a/tests/integration/targets/kubevirt_vmi_info/runme.sh b/tests/integration/targets/kubevirt_vmi_info/runme.sh index d090714..ae28c77 100755 --- a/tests/integration/targets/kubevirt_vmi_info/runme.sh +++ b/tests/integration/targets/kubevirt_vmi_info/runme.sh @@ -3,6 +3,10 @@ set -eux export ANSIBLE_CALLBACKS_ENABLED=ansible.posix.profile_tasks +if [ -f "extra_vars.sh" ]; then + source extra_vars.sh +fi + NAMESPACE="test-kubevirt-vmi-info-$(tr -dc '[:lower:]' < /dev/urandom | head -c 5)" cleanup() {